Overview
Ketamine, once primarily known as a dissociative anesthetic, is now recognized for its profound therapeutic potential, particularly in treating severe depression and other mental health conditions. Its unique mechanism of action, primarily as an NMDA receptor antagonist, allows for rapid antidepressant effects that differ significantly from traditional psychiatric medications. While its anesthetic properties were established in the 1960s, the exploration of its sub-anesthetic doses for mood disorders gained significant traction in the early 21st century, leading to the development of treatments like esketamine nasal spray. This shift has opened new avenues for individuals suffering from treatment-resistant depression, chronic pain, and PTSD, offering hope where other therapies have failed. However, its use is not without controversy, involving careful medical supervision due to potential side effects and risks of misuse.
🎵 Origins & History
The journey of ketamine began in the early 1960s at Parke, Davis & Company (now part of Pfizer). Ketamine was synthesized as a safer alternative to PCP, another dissociative anesthetic with significant side effects. Initial trials in the early 1960s, particularly by Max L. Wallace, demonstrated its efficacy as a dissociative anesthetic with a more favorable safety profile. Approved by the U.S. Food and Drug Administration in 1970, ketamine quickly became a vital tool in emergency medicine and surgery due to its rapid onset and ability to preserve respiratory drive, a stark contrast to many other anesthetics of the era. Its widespread adoption in clinical settings, from battlefield medicine during the Vietnam War to pediatric care, cemented its status as an essential anesthetic agent.
⚙️ How It Works
Ketamine's therapeutic magic lies in its unique interaction with the brain's neurochemistry, primarily through its role as an NMDA receptor antagonist. Unlike traditional antidepressants that target monoamine systems like serotonin and norepinephrine, ketamine's rapid antidepressant effects are thought to stem from its ability to quickly increase synaptic levels of glutamate, the brain's primary excitatory neurotransmitter. This surge in glutamate activity then triggers downstream signaling pathways, including the activation of BRAF and mTOR, which promote the growth of new synaptic connections, a process known as synaptogenesis. This neuroplastic effect is believed to be crucial in reversing the neuronal atrophy associated with chronic stress and depression, offering a swift and powerful intervention for mood disorders. The specific enantiomer, esketamine, has been further refined for its antidepressant properties.

🤔 Controversies & Debates
The rapid antidepressant effects of ketamine, while revolutionary, are not without their challenges and debates. Concerns persist regarding the long-term safety of repeated ketamine use, particularly potential bladder toxicity (ketamine cystitis) and cognitive impairments, though these are more commonly associated with chronic recreational abuse than supervised therapeutic use. The mechanism of action, while increasingly understood, still holds mysteries, with ongoing debate about the precise pathways responsible for its antidepressant effects and the role of metabolites. Furthermore, the high cost of ketamine therapy and issues of insurance coverage create significant access barriers for many patients, sparking debates about healthcare equity and the classification of ketamine as a 'lifestyle drug' versus essential medicine. The potential for misuse and diversion also remains a significant concern for regulatory agencies and law enforcement.

💡 Practical Applications
Ketamine's primary practical application is in anesthesia, where it's used for induction and maintenance, particularly in emergency settings and for pediatric patients due to its safety profile and preserved airway reflexes. Beyond anesthesia, its most significant therapeutic use is in treating treatment-resistant depression (TRD), where it is administered via intravenous infusion or intranasal spray (esketamine). It's also increasingly used for chronic pain management, including neuropathic pain and fibromyalgia, often at sub-anesthetic doses.
